2x+7=5x-23

To solve the equation 2x + 7 = 5x - 23, we need to isolate the variable x on one side of the equation.

First, let's subtract 2x from both sides to eliminate the x term from the left side of the equation:

2x + 7 - 2x = 5x - 23 - 2x

Simplifying the left side gives:

7 = 3x - 23

Next, let's add 23 to both sides to eliminate the constant term from the right side of the equation:

7 + 23 = 3x - 23 + 23

Simplifying the right side gives:

30 = 3x

Finally, divide both sides by 3 to solve for x:

30/3 = 3x/3

Simplifying gives:

10 = x

Therefore, the solution to the equation 2x + 7 = 5x - 23 is x = 10.
